把电源接上,PLC上的开关不需要打到什么状态的,随便在你写入的时候PLC会自动跳到STOP状态的。成新上传程序它会自动停止运行,上传完毕后尽量先把机器复位在启动或者是先把机器停止下来在上传新的程序避免机器在运行的时候上传程序导致什么故障的!
以下是三菱plc常用的指令,还有不懂的可以问我一程序流程控制指令—~09
条件转移
子程序调用
子程序返回
中断返回
主程序结束
监控定时器刷新
循环开始
循环结束
二传送、比较指令—~----二进制BCD----十进制
区间比较
码移位传送
取反传送
数据块传送(n点→n点)
多点传送(1点→n点)
数据交换,(D0)←→(D2)
变换,BIN→BCD
变换,BCD→BIN
三算术、逻辑运算指令—~----二进制BCD----十进制
求BIN补码
四循环、移位指令—~39
循环右移
循环左移
带进位循环右移
带进位循环左移
五数据处理指令—~49
区间复位
求置ON位总数
求平均值
信号报警器标志置位
信号报警器标志复位
整数→BIN浮点数六高速处理指令—~59
输入输出刷新
输入滤波时间常数调整
矩阵输入
高速记数器比较置位
高速记数器比较复位
高速记数器区间比较
速度检测
脉冲输出
脉冲宽度调制
带加减速功能的脉冲输出
七方便指令—~69
状态初始化
数据搜索
绝对值凸轮顺控
增量凸轮顺控
示教定时器
用定时器—可定义
交替输出
斜坡输出
旋转工作台控制
数据排序
八外部I/O设备指令—~79
键输入
拨码开关输入
七段译码
带锁存的七段码显示
方向开关
打印输出
读特殊功能模块
写特殊功能模块
九外围设备指令—~89
-串行通讯
并行运行
十六进制→ASCII
→十六进制
电位器读入
电位器设定
十F2外部模块指令—~99
-,Mini网
-6A,模拟量输入
**2-6*,模拟量输出
-,启动RM
-,写RM
-,读RM
-,监控RM
-,指定块
-,机器码十一浮点数运算指令—~
ECMPBIN浮点数比较
EZCPBIN浮点数区间比较
EBCDBIN浮点数→BCD浮点数
EBINBCD浮点数→BIN浮点数
EADDBIN浮点数加法
ESUBBIN浮点数减法
EMULBIN浮点数乘法
EDIVBIN浮点数除法
ESQRBIN浮点数开方
INTBIN浮点数→BIN整数
SINBIN浮点数正弦函数(SIN)
COSBIN浮点数余弦函数(COS)
TANBIN浮点数正切函数(TAN)
十二交换指令—
SWAP高低字节交换
十三定位指令—~
ABS读当前绝对值位置
ZRN返回原点
PLSY变速脉冲输出
DRVI增量式单速位置控制
DRVA绝对式单速位置控制
十四时钟运算指令—~
TCMP时钟数据比较
TZCP时钟数据区间比较
TADD时钟数据加法
TSUB时钟数据减法
TRD时钟数据读出
TWR时钟数据写入
HOUR小时定时器
十五变换指令—~
GRY二进制数→格雷码
GBIN格雷码→二进制数
读FXon-3A模拟量模块
写FXon-3A模拟量模块
十六触点比较指令—~
LD=(S1)=(S2)时运算开始之触点接通
LD>(S1)>(S2)时运算开始之触点接通
LD<(S1)<(S2)时运算开始之触点接通
LD<>(S1)≠(S2)时运算开始之触点接通
LD≤(S1)≤(S2)时运算开始之触点接通
LD≥(S1)≥(S2)时运算开始之触点接通
AND=(S1)=(S2)时串联触点接通
AND>(S1)>(S2)时串联触点接通
AND<(S1)<(S2)时串联触点接通
AND<>(S1)≠(S2)时串联触点接通
AND≤(S1)≤(S2)时串联触点接通
AND≥(S1)≥(S2)时串联触点接通
OR=(S1)=(S2)时并联触点接通
OR>(S1)>(S2)时并联触点接通
OR<(S1)<(S2)时并联触点接通
OR<>(S1)≠(S2)时并联触点接通
OR≤(S1)≤(S2)时并联触点接通
OR≥(S1)≥(S2)时并联触点接通